Step 1: Emergency Response
We’ll dispatch our crew to your property within 60 minutes to assess the situation and create a plan. Our technicians will arrive equipped with the necessary tools and equipment to begin the drying process. We’ll work quickly to extract standing water and set up equipment to dry out your property.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Our technicians will use heavy-duty pumps and vacuums to remove standing water from your property.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th. We’ll carefully move furniture, electronics, and other valuables to safe areas to protect them from dam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our crew will set up dehumidifiers and fans to dry out your property and remove excess moisture.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and ensuring that your property is completely dry. We’ll work closely with you to monitor the drying process and make adjustments as needed.
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ection
Once your property is dry, our technicians will clean and disinfect all surfaces and materials to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ria. We’ll use industrial-grade cleaning products and equipment to ensure a thorough cleaning. We’ll also dispose of any damaged or unsalvageable materials.
Step 5: Restoration and Repair
Our crew will work with you to identify and repair any damaged structural elements, including drywall, flooring, and ceilings. We’ll use high-quality materials and techniques to ensure a seamless repair. We’ll also work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.

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Repair
Ignoring these signs can lead to costly repairs and even health hazards. Catching them early saves you money and prevents bigger problems. Don’t wait until it’s too late, act quickly to prevent further damage.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Unpleasant odors can be a sign of hidden moisture and mold growth. If you notice persistent musty smells, it’s essential to investigate further.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and address the issue before it becomes a bigger problem.
Visible Water Stains
Water stains on your ceiling or walls can be a sign of a leak or water damage. Don’t ignore these stains, they can lead to structural damage and costly repairs. Our crew will investigate the source of the leak and repair any damaged areas to prevent further damage.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Buckled or warped flooring can be a sign of water damage under the surface. Our technicians will inspect your flooring and identify the source of the issue. We’ll repair or replace the affected area to ensure your home remains safe and secure.

Water Damage Repair Cost in Clifton Springs, NY
Water damage repair costs can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Clifton Springs, NY. These estimates are approximate and may not reflect the actual cost of your project.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ment required.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Time required for drying, equipment needed, and labor costs. |
| Cleaning and Disinfection |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of surfaces, and equipment required. |
| Restoration and Repair | $2,000 – $10,000 | Severity of damage, materials needed, and labor costs. |
| Insurance Claims Help | Free | We’ll work closely with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process. |
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and inspection by our team. We offer free estimates and consultations to help you understand the cost of your project.

Common Questions About Water Damage Repair
Q: How long does water damage repair take?
A: The length of time for water damage repair varies dep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. In general, it can take anywhere from a few days to several weeks to complete. Our team will work closely with you to ensure a timely and efficient repair process. We’ll keep you informed every step of the way.
Q: Is water damage repair covered by insurance?
A: Yes, water damage repair is typically covered by most homeowners insurance policies. Our team will work closely with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process and increase your coverage. We’ll handle the paperwork and communicate with your insurance company on your behalf.
Q: What are the risks of ignoring water damage repair?
A: Ignoring water damage repair can lead to costly repairs, health hazards, and even structural damage to your home. Hidden moisture and mold growth can spread rapidly, causing further damage and needing more extensive repairs. Don’t wait, act quickly to prevent further damage.
Q: How can I prevent water damage in the future?
A: Regular maintenance, inspections, and repairs can help prevent water damage. Our team recommends checking your home’s plumbing system, inspecting your roof and gutters, and addressing any leaks or water stains quickly. Stay proactive, schedule regular maintenance and inspections to prevent water damage.
